首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何让用户设置2D Vector的行大小和列大小?

要让用户设置2D Vector的行大小和列大小,可以通过以下步骤实现:

  1. 创建一个2D Vector对象,用于存储行和列的数据。可以使用编程语言提供的数据结构,如数组或列表。
  2. 提供一个用户界面,让用户输入所需的行大小和列大小。可以使用前端开发技术,如HTML和CSS,创建一个表单或输入框。
  3. 在后端开发中,接收用户输入的行大小和列大小。可以使用后端编程语言,如Java、Python或Node.js,处理用户的输入。
  4. 对用户输入进行验证和处理。确保输入的行大小和列大小是有效的,例如大于0的整数。
  5. 使用设置好的行大小和列大小,初始化2D Vector对象。根据用户输入的行大小和列大小,创建一个二维数组或列表。
  6. 将初始化好的2D Vector对象返回给用户或在后续的程序中使用。

以下是一个示例的代码片段(使用Python语言):

代码语言:txt
复制
class TwoDVector:
    def __init__(self, rows, cols):
        self.vector = [[0] * cols for _ in range(rows)]

# 前端界面示例(HTML和CSS):
<form>
    <label for="rows">行大小:</label>
    <input type="number" id="rows" name="rows" min="1">
    <br>
    <label for="cols">列大小:</label>
    <input type="number" id="cols" name="cols" min="1">
    <br>
    <input type="submit" value="提交">
</form>

# 后端处理示例(使用Python的Flask框架):
from flask import Flask, request, jsonify

app = Flask(__name__)

@app.route('/create_vector', methods=['POST'])
def create_vector():
    rows = int(request.form['rows'])
    cols = int(request.form['cols'])
    vector = TwoDVector(rows, cols)
    return jsonify(vector=vector.vector)

# 推荐的腾讯云相关产品和产品介绍链接地址:
- 云服务器(CVM):https://cloud.tencent.com/product/cvm
- 云函数(SCF):https://cloud.tencent.com/product/scf
- 云数据库 MySQL 版(CMYSQL):https://cloud.tencent.com/product/cmysql
- 云存储(COS):https://cloud.tencent.com/product/cos
- 人工智能(AI):https://cloud.tencent.com/product/ai
- 物联网(IoT):https://cloud.tencent.com/product/iotexplorer
- 区块链(BCBaaS):https://cloud.tencent.com/product/baas
- 腾讯云元宇宙:https://cloud.tencent.com/solution/virtual-universe

请注意,以上示例代码仅为演示目的,实际实现可能因编程语言和框架而异。同时,腾讯云产品链接仅供参考,具体选择应根据实际需求和情况进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Unity基础(24)-UGUI

    组件属性 Source Image(图像源):纹理格式为Sprite(2D and UI)的图片资源(导入图片后选择Texture Type为Sprite(2D and UI))。 Color(颜色):图片叠加的颜色。 Material(材质):图片叠加的材质,可以用来实现一些特殊效果,如凹凸感觉 Raycast Target(射线投射目标):是否作为射线投射目标,关闭之后忽略UGUI的射线检测。 Set Native Size:点击此按钮则 Image 组件的长宽自动与原图片长宽一致 Image Type(图片显示类型): Simple(基本的):图片整张全显示,不裁切,不叠加,根据边框大小会有拉伸。 Preserve Aspect(锁定比例):针对Simple模式,勾选之后,无论图片的外形放大还是缩小,都会一直保持初始的长宽比例。

    02
    领券